How long is the warranty period for GCL photovoltaic panels
GCL offers not-so-bad warranties for its solar panels. The product warranty covers 12 years, while the performance warranty ensures that the panels will retain at least 85% of their initial power output after 25 or 30 years of operation. How long is the flywheel energy storage interval
FESS is used for short-time storage and typically offered with a charging/discharging duration between 20 seconds and 20 minutes. However, one 4-hour duration system is available on the market. . Flywheel energy storage (FES) works by spinning a rotor (flywheel) and maintaining the energy in the system as rotational energy. When energy is extracted from the system, the flywheel's rotational speed is reduced as a consequence of the principle of conservation of energy; adding energy to the. .
